Abstract

The utility model discloses a template cleaning device, which comprises a mounting rack, wherein a cutter is arranged on the mounting rack, and the cutter can move along the mounting rack to clean the resin on the surface of a template; the device also comprises a pressure adjusting mechanism, and the pressure adjusting mechanism is used for adjusting the pressure of the cutter on the surface of the template. The utility model discloses a cutter can remove along the mounting bracket, in order to clear away the resin on template surface, it need not the manual work and takes the spiller to clear up, high temperature template and the molten resin of 220 ℃ and above have effectively been avoided causing the problem of scald to operating personnel, it can improve the clearance quality of template, improve cleaning efficiency, reduced because of the clearance unclean, untimely lead to extrusion granulation unit to be blockked up by the resin cladding, cause the unable start of extrusion granulation unit short time, then can cause the problem of polyolefin apparatus for producing shut down when serious, the production efficiency of polyolefin is improved.

Background
In the polyolefin production device, an extrusion granulator unit is a core unit, and a scraper knife is manually taken to clean a template during the traditional start and stop. However, as the volume of the polyolefin production device is larger and larger, the driving load of the extrusion granulator unit is larger and larger, the size of the template is larger and larger, and the installation height of the template is even more than 2 meters. Traditional manual cleaning mode is difficult to the clean up, cleaning speed is slower, and exceed 220 ℃'s template and molten resin and very easily cause the scald to operating personnel, especially when producing the polyolefin of high, super high melt index, the in-process of driving need constantly clear up the template fast, resin outflow speed can make template clearance frequency and the degree of difficulty sharply increase too fast, if the template clearance untimely leads to extrusion granulation unit to be blockked up by the resin cladding easily, cause the unable start-up of extrusion granulation unit short time, then can cause polyolefin apparatus for producing to stop production in serious time, the production efficiency of polyolefin has been influenced.

Detailed Description
Examples
As shown in fig. 1 and 2, the present embodiment provides a formwork cleaning apparatus, which includes a mounting frame, the mounting frame is disposed near the formwork 1, and a cutter is movably disposed on the mounting frame, and the cutter is movable along the mounting frame to remove resin on the surface of the formwork 1. The die holes of the die plate 1 are uniformly distributed along the edge of the die plate 1, so that the resin can be ensured to pass through the die holes in the granulation process, and the required shape and quality of a product are effectively ensured. The cutter is tightly attached to the surface of the template 1, and the cutter can move left and right or move up and down to cut off the molten resin flowing out of the die hole, so that the template 1 is kept clean, and the extrusion granulator unit is prevented from being blocked by resin coating and cannot be started up in a short time. The utility model discloses need not the manual work and take the spiller to clear up, effectively avoided 220 ℃ and above high temperature template 1 and molten resin to cause the problem of scald to operating personnel.
The cleaning device further comprises a pressure adjusting mechanism, wherein the pressure adjusting mechanism is used for adjusting the pressure of the cutter on the surface of the template 1, so that the cutter can better cut off resin, and the cleaning work of the template 1 is completed. Wherein, the mounting rack and the main stressed components are made of carbon steel to ensure the mechanical strength; the cutter is made of beryllium bronze to protect the template 1 from damage.
The utility model discloses be applied to 1 clearance operations of template during extrusion granulator set driving, can reduce manpower consumption, ensure template 1's clearance quality for template 1's clearance speed, guarantee template 1's clearance safety is driven to large-scale extrusion granulator set, or in the production of various model extrusion granulator set, high, super high melt index's license plate driving is especially effective.
In an exemplary embodiment, the mounting frame comprises a frame body 2, the frame body 2 is provided with two sliding rails 3, each sliding rail 3 is provided with a sliding part, and two ends of the cutting knife are respectively connected with the two sliding parts. Two slide rails 3 are usually vertically arranged, the two vertically arranged slide rails 3 are respectively positioned at two sides of the template 1, and the cutter can move up and down along the slide rails 3 to realize the cleaning function of the template 1. It should be noted that the two slide rails 3 may also be transversely arranged, so that the cutter can move left and right along the slide rails 3.
As shown in fig. 2, preferably, both ends of the sliding rail 3 are provided with synchronizing wheels 4, a synchronizing chain 5 is arranged between the two synchronizing wheels 4, and the synchronizing chain 5 is fixedly connected with the sliding member. The frame body 2 rotates and is equipped with synchronizing shaft 6, the both ends of synchronizing shaft 6 are connected with synchronizing wheel 4 of two slide rails 3 respectively. When the cutter slides up and down, the two sliding parts respectively slide up and down along the two sliding rails 3, and under the action of the synchronizing shaft 6, the synchronizing wheel 4 and the synchronizing chain 5, the two sliding parts can synchronously move, and the two ends of the cutter are kept horizontal, so that the cleaning effect of the template 1 can be improved. The utility model discloses can guarantee the traffic direction and the route of marcing of cutter, make the cutter remove along 1 surface of template and realize the clearance function.
Specifically, the slider includes coaster 7, coaster 7 and slide rail 3 sliding fit, coaster 7 is connected with bracing piece 8, bracing piece 8 is connected with the cutter. The supporting rod 8 is transversely arranged, the supporting rod 8 is perpendicular to the sliding rail 3, the supporting rod 8 has a certain length, and the pressure of the pressure adjusting mechanism for adjusting the pressure of the cutter on the surface of the template 1 is facilitated.
As shown in fig. 1, the cutter comprises a cutter body 9, driving handles 10 are arranged at two ends of the cutter body 9, and the driving handles 10 are connected with a support rod 8. The length of the cutter body 9 is matched with the diameter of the template 1, the driving handle 10 extends to the outer side of the slide rail 3, an operator can hold the driving handle 10 to control the cutter body 9 to move upwards or downwards quickly, and molten resin flowing out of a die hole is cut off. Preferably, the cutter is provided with an upper cutter edge and a lower cutter edge, the upper cutter edge and the lower cutter edge form an inclined angle with the surface of the template 1, the upper cutter edge is arranged obliquely upwards, the lower cutter edge is arranged obliquely downwards, and when the cutter moves up and down, the upper cutter edge and the lower cutter edge can remove resin on the surface of the template 1, so that the cleaning work of the template 1 can be completed better.
The driving handle 10 is provided with a mounting through hole matched with the supporting rod 8, the driving handle 10 is connected with the supporting rod 8 in a sliding mode through the mounting through hole, and the pressure adjusting mechanism can adjust the relative position of the supporting rod 8 and the driving handle 10, so that the pressure of the cutter on the surface of the template 1 can be adjusted. The supporting rod 8 penetrates through an installation through hole of the driving handle 10, and the position of the driving handle 10 is adjusted through the pressure adjusting mechanism, so that the pressing force of the cutter is adjusted, and the cleaning work of the template 1 is better completed.
As shown in fig. 2, in one embodiment, the pressure adjusting mechanism includes an adjusting spring 11 and a limiting member, the adjusting spring 11 is sleeved on the supporting rod 8, two ends of the adjusting spring 11 are respectively in contact with the pulley 7 and the driving handle 10, the limiting member is movably disposed on the supporting rod 8 and limits the driving handle 10, the adjusting spring 11 is in a compressed state, the adjusting spring 11 and the limiting member respectively apply opposite acting forces to the driving handle 10, and the pressing force of the blade body on the surface of the die plate 1 is adjusted by adjusting the compressed state of the adjusting spring 11.
Preferably, the locating part includes stop nut 12, the tip of bracing piece 8 be equipped with the external screw thread of stop nut 12 adaptation, stop nut 12 and 8 threaded connection of bracing piece, and stop nut 12 supports tightly with one side that adjusting spring 11 was kept away from to driving handle 10. The driving handle 10 is connected with the cutter body, and both can move simultaneously. The adjusting spring 11 is in a compressed state, the adjusting spring 11 provides elastic force for the driving handle 10, the limiting nut 12 provides pressure for the driving handle 10, and the pressing force of the cutter on the surface of the template 1 can be adjusted by adjusting the position of the limiting nut 12.
As shown in fig. 1, as an alternative of this embodiment, the top and the bottom of the mounting rack are both provided with extension slideways 13, the two extension slideways 13 are respectively located at the top and the bottom of the die plate 1, the extension slideways 13 are provided with two stainless steel strips, the surfaces of the two stainless steel strips and the surface of the die plate 1 are located on the same plane, and the extension slideways can enable the cutter to cut off the resin quickly and smoothly without affecting the normal operation of the extrusion granulator unit.
